Tex. Business & Commerce Code § 57.251: DEFINITION OF TERMINATE AND TERMINATION.
Where this section sits in the code
- BUSINESS AND COMMERCE CODE
- TITLE 4. BUSINESS OPPORTUNITIES AND AGREEMENTS
- CHAPTER 57. AGRICULTURAL, CONSTRUCTION, INDUSTRIAL, MINING, FORESTRY, LANDSCAPING, AND OUTDOOR POWER EQUIPMENT DEALER AGREEMENTS
- SUBCHAPTER F. WARRANTY CLAIMS
For purposes of this subchapter, "terminate" and "termination" do not include the phrase substantially change the competitive circumstances of a dealer agreement.
Added by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 1039 (H.B. 3079), Sec. 2, eff. September 1, 2011.
